Self-efficacy (1) is a construct derived from the Social Cognitive Theory and refers to confidence in one's ability to perform specific behaviors in specific situations. The stages of change an individual progresses through with regards to exercise behaviour can be explained using the TTM, and an individual would be considered within the Pre-contemplation stage when they have no desire to take up exercise, and are uninformed of the benefits (Prochaska & Velicer, 1997). Adam and White (2005) suggest that stage based activity promotion interventions do not always work, and that exercise behaviour is too complex to be simplified to five stages of change. Due to lifestyle changes over the past twenty five years which have seen fewer people walking and cycling, and a decrease within the proportion of people employed within manual labour, promotion of increased levels of physical activity through interventions such as those based on Prochaska and Di Clemente’s (1982) Transtheoretical Model (TTM) of behavioural change have become increasingly necessary in order to increase physical activity participation levels. Increased levels of exercise are noted within action and maintenance stages, as compared with pre-contemplation, contemplation, and preparation stages (De Bourdeaudhuij et al., 2005). Stage based activity promotion programmes can be seen to be effective in the short term, but there is little longitudinal evidence to support the effectiveness of the model over time.
